Lewis J. Altfest, PhD, CFA, CPA/PFS, CFP
Lew Altfest, Ph.D., CFA, CFP®, CPA/PFS has been practicing fee-only investment management and personal financial planning for over 25 years. He has been named one of the “Best Financial Advisors” in the country by Barron’s, as well as by Medical Economics, Dental Practice Report, Money, and Worth. He is a sought after speaker and frequently interviewed by the media in such places as the Wall Street Journal, PBS’s Nightly Business Report, The New York Times and CNBC. Lew Altfest is an Associate Professor of Finance at the Lubin School of Business at Pace University, where he teaches financial planning and investments. His academic textbook, Personal Financial Planning, was published by McGraw Hill and is currently used at leading universities around the country. Lew is also co-author of Lew Altfest Answers Almost All Your Questions About Money, which was named one of the best financial planning books by Money magazine, and co-author of An Introduction to Business. |
